The November Toronto meetup will feature Daniel Lerch, author of Post Carbon Cities. Daniel, a former planner in Portland, Oregon, is with Post Carbon Institute, and will be here on a book tour.

"Post Carbon Cities: Planning for Energy and Climate Uncertainty" is a guidebook on peak oil and global warming for people who work with and for local governments in the United States and Canada. It provides a sober look at how these phenomena are quickly creating new uncertainties and vulnerabilities for cities of all sizes, and explains what local decision-makers can do to address these challenges.

Post Carbon Cities fills an important gap in the resources currently available to local government decision-makers on planning for the changing global energy and climate context of the 21st century.
